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
É possível retornar mais de um campo no CASE WHEN no Firebird 1.5?
Por Exemplo, no momento estou utilizando da seguinte forma...
SELECT
CASE EMPRESA.ENDERECO_COBRANCA
WHEN 1 THEN EMPRESA.RUA_MATRIZ
WHEN 2 THEN EMPRESA.RUA_FILIAL
END AS RUA_COBRANCA,
CASE EMPRESA.ENDERECO_COBRANCA
WHEN 1 THEN EMPRESA.BAIRRO_MATRIZ
WHEN 2 THEN EMPRESA.BAIRRO_FILIAL
END AS BAIRRO_COBRANCA
FROM EMPRESA
Gostaria de saber, é possível fazer com que o case retorno os dois campos em uma só cláusula? Ou seja, unir os dois cases...
Obrigado.
Carregando comentários...